Lineage and Honors Information as of 12 June 2013

553d ENGINEER DETACHMENT

  • Constituted 21 June 1943 in the Army of the United States as the 2008th Engineer Aviation Fire Fighting Platoon
  • Activated 1 July 1943 at Bradley Field, Connecticut
  • Inactivated 31 December 1945 in Germany
  • Redesignated 4 April 1951 as the 523d Engineer Fire Fighting Platoon, allotted to the Regular Army, and activated at Fort Leonard Wood, Missouri
  • Reorganized and redesignated 20 October 1953 as the 553d Engineer Detachment
  • Inactivated 3 December 1954 in France
  • Activated 29 October 1955 at Fort Belvoir, Virginia
  • Inactivated 1 February 1958 at Fort Belvoir, Virginia
  • Activated 25 September 1959 in Korea
  • Inactivated 1 May 1964 in Korea
  • Activated 25 June 1964 at Fort Devens, Massachusetts
  • Inactivated 23 August 1968 in Vietnam
  • Activated 21 June 1976 at Fort Drum, New York
  • Inactivated 15 September 1987 at Fort Drum, New York
  • Activated 16 October 2007 at New York, New York

CAMPAIGN PARTICIPATION CREDIT

  • World War II
  • Normandy
  • Northern France
  • Rhineland
  • Central Europe
  • Vietnam
  • Defense
  • Counteroffensive
  • Counteroffensive, Phase II
  • Counteroffensive, Phase III
  • Tet Counteroffensive
  • Counteroffensive, Phase IV
  • Counteroffensive, Phase V
  • War on Terrorism
  • Campaigns to be determined

DECORATIONS

  • Meritorious Unit Commendation (Army), Streamer embroidered VIETNAM 1966-1967
  • Meritorious Unit Commendation (Army), Streamer embroidered VIETNAM 1967-1968
